The emblematic emblem of Koszyk

The emblematic emblem, or blazon of Koszyk, is a unique representation that includes multiple elements, such as a shield with particular figures, distinctive colors (enamels), and occasionally exterior ornaments that denote the hierarchy or title of its bearer. The different components of the emblematic emblem of Koszyk are arranged following strict heraldic rules, and each one has a specific meaning. The colors, figures (positions), and designs (partitions and borders) intertwine to form a symbol that is both an artistic expression and an identification system.

Relationship of the heraldic shield with the surname Koszyk

The connection between the heraldic shield and Koszyk is a mix of history and tradition. Initially, coats of arms were awarded to specific individuals, not entire families, and were related to the deeds, titles or social status of the person in question. As time passed, the Koszyk shield became hereditary, becoming an emblematic symbol of the family lineage and, therefore, associated with the surname Koszyk.
